1. Understanding Trezor® Bridge

What Is Trezor Bridge?

Trezor Bridge is an official communication interface developed by Trezor to help your hardware wallet interact directly with your computer’s browser. It works in the background, allowing Trezor Suite or supported web applications to detect the Trezor device securely and reliably.

Before the Bridge existed, Trezor used browser extensions for device communication, but extensions came with limitations and security concerns. Bridge replaced all that with a more secure, flexible, and stable solution.

Why Is It Important?

Trezor Bridge enables:

  • Secure USB communication

  • Smooth device detection in Trezor Suite

  • Browser compatibility across major OS

  • Improved stability compared to old extensions

If your Trezor isn’t recognized by your computer or Trezor Suite, 90% of the time, Bridge is involved — either missing, corrupted, or outdated.

6. Common Issues & Troubleshooting Trezor® Bridge

Even though Trezor Bridge is stable, some users may face connectivity issues. Here are the most common ones and how to fix them.

Issue 1: Trezor Device Not Detected

Solutions

  • Ensure Trezor Bridge is installed and running.

  • Restart your browser (Chrome, Brave, Firefox).

  • Try a different USB port or cable.

  • Make sure no other wallet app is open and blocking the USB interface.

Issue 2: Trezor Suite Says “Reconnect Device” Continuously

Solutions

  • Uninstall Bridge and reinstall the latest version.

  • Disable conflicting extensions like ad blockers or privacy tools.

  • Restart your computer.

Issue 3: Linux Users Face Permission Denied Errors

Solutions

  • Install udev rules from the official site.

  • Run:


     

    sudo udevadm control --reload-rules sudo udevadm trigger

Issue 4: Bridge Not Updating Automatically

Solutions

  • Manually download and reinstall Bridge.

  • Clear browser cache related to Trezor Suite.

  • Ensure no firewall is blocking Bridge processes.

9. Trezor Bridge vs. WebUSB (Browser-Native Communication)

While many modern browsers offer WebUSB, Trezor still recommends Bridge for most users.

WebUSB Pros

  • No software installation required

  • Works directly in browser

WebUSB Cons

  • Not supported on all browsers

  • Less stable for long sessions

  • Some advanced functions require Bridge

Trezor Bridge remains the most reliable option, especially for managing multiple assets, running firmware upgrades, or working on Linux systems.
